(1)A joint committee under section ninety-one of the [23 & 24 Geo. 5. c. 51.] Local Government Act, 1933, shall not be appointed for the purposes of this Act without the prior approval of the Secretary of State.
(2)For the avoidance of doubt it is hereby declared that a combination scheme may be submitted and approved under section five of this Act or may be made under section six thereof notwithstanding that a joint committee under the said section ninety-one has been appointed for fire service purposes for all or some of the areas in respect of which the combination scheme is submitted or made.
